We can sometimes feel alone or lonely, even when we are surrounded by people. We don’t always know why we feel this way, and we don’t always know what to do to change the feeling. But by doing this simple meditation, where you will invite supportive people in to join you, the sense of loneliness should pass leaving you feeling happier in yourself.

So wherever you are,

Whether sitting or lying down,

I invite you to make yourself comfortable and gently close your eyes.

Take a deep breath in,

As deep as you like,

And now slowly release that breath.

Again,

Take a breath in,

A little deeper than before,

And now slowly release that breath.

As you take one last breath in,

Really fill your body with air and slowly release that breath.

As you breathe at your own pace,

You notice your body feels relaxed and your mind centered.

Check that your shoulders are truly relaxed as we begin this meditation.

In your mind's eye,

You are going to bring three people before you.

Three people either in spirit or still walking on the earth plane.

Three people whose opinion you value.

You may have difficulty choosing these people.

You may feel you should choose someone family related or someone you have spent a lot of time with.

But choose carefully.

This is your choice and yours alone.

Don't feel pressured in any way.

Choose three people who you trust,

Who you know want the best for you.

With the three people you have chosen,

You sit together in a place that is comfortable to you.

A place which feels warm and welcoming.

Settled,

You look at the three familiar faces in front of you.

You ask each of them in turn,

Do you love me?

And wait for their answer.

These people adore you and their answer warms your heart.

Next you ask each of them in turn,

What words of wisdom do you have for me?

Each of these people want the best for you and their words of wisdom will lift you up.

Take your time with each person so they can give you the words needed to inspire you.

Having received their messages and words of wisdom,

You no longer feel lonely or unmotivated.

You feel warm and inspired.

Knowing you are on the right path with someone always in touch with you.

Spiritually guiding and creating opportunities for you.

You thank each person in turn,

Letting them know how their kindness and support has made you feel.

It's time to say goodbye.

And after each farewell,

The people before you slowly disappear.

They have left you with the knowing that you can call on them anytime you need some uplifting words.

You come back to your room and you take a deep breath in as you wiggle your fingers and toes.

And as you release the breath,

You slowly open your eyes.

The feeling of loneliness is now a distant memory and the thought of its return no longer worries you.

As you know,

You can return to this meditation whenever you need to.
